WebJul 6, 2024 · The life cycle of Blastocystis is initiated upon ingestion of cysts by the host. The parasite then subsequently excyst, develop into vacuolar forms, and colonize the large intestines. ... Boreham, P.F.L. WebApr 8, 2013 · Background. Blastocystis sp. is one of the most common intestinal protozoa found in the human intestinal tract.Blastocystis infection is widely distributed throughout the world with a high prevalence in developing countries in the tropics and subtropics [1,2].Human infection is associated with poor personal hygiene, lack of sanitation, …
